Following Argentina's 1-0 extra-time defeat to Spain in the FIFA World Cup final, clashes erupted near Buenos Aires' Obelisk as disappointed supporters confronted police. Thousands had gathered across the capital hoping to see Lionel Messi's side retain the title, but celebrations turned into unrest after the final whistle. Police deployed tear gas and water cannons to disperse crowds after some protesters allegedly threw objects at officers. Authorities eventually cleared the area and restored order.
